Transaction 63be3bc9e36697c980e2d92ac6a6020286590eafd23c1c96c878dd8ef65ea5b8
1 Input
1 Output
-
63be3bc9e36697c980e2d92ac6a6020286590eafd23c1c96c878dd8ef65ea5b8:0
- value
- 61959
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3617f527bd985c22c381cb8e901001b1ba68c6c
- address
- bc1qudsh75nmmxzuytpcrjuwjqgqrvd6drrv5s66lf